A North Texas teacher could face up to 40 years in prison if convicted on charges that he allegedly had sex with a 16-year-old female student, who he offered good grades in exchange for keeping the relationship secret from his wife.
James Lester Quigley, a 34-year-old teacher at Richardson High School, has been charged with one count of improper relationship between an educator and student and one count of sexual assault. Both charges are second degree felonies, each punishable by up to 20 years in prison.
